We stayed on the Executive floor in 2 rooms - a corner king and deluxe twin. The corner king was larger with a larger sitting area with a couch and side chair. The deluxe twin had a small couch. We had the breakfast buffet each morning on the executive floor which was good with both Japanese and western dishes. Both rooms were extremely clean and comfortable. Bathrooms were very clean with well stocked amenities. Rooms had Nespresso machines, teas and drinks and we could go to Executive lunge for snacks, tea, happy hour. It was nice to be able to watch the sunset at the end of a day of visiting Tokyo with a glass of wine. The staff was very helpful in making reservations for us and helping us to pack and ship two boxes back to the states. The Shibuya area can be a bit crazy in the busy parts but this hotel is a bit off to the side which is really nice, but still very close to the Shibuya station for super easy transportation options around Tokyo. This was our second stay here and we would definitely plan to stay here again for future stays in Tokyo.

We enjoyed the size of the room !! It was spacioys an comfortable for travellers rsp like us who had 5 pcs of large sized luggage The bed and pillows were nice and comfortable!! We enjoyed very much the full breakfast spread & the daily English newspaper !! Loved their coffee, fruits, fresh orange juice, croissants, danone yoghurt, mixed japanese rice, miso soup etc etc The service personnel in their different restaurants where we had breakfasts were very polite, attentive and efficient ! We also enjoyed our Bento box in the Japanese restaurant and the Sichuan Food in the other hotel resto! Will try their bar the next time we visit! The concierge gave us very helpful details on how to use the train and subways to reach our diff destinations. I like also that there is playroom for toddlers and a dental clinic in the propery !
